§ 56-3-2840 — Other registration and licensing provisions unaffected; penalties for violations.

Text
The provisions of this article do not affect the registration and licensing of motor vehicles as required by other provisions of this chapter but are cumulative thereto. Any person violating the provisions of this article or any person who (a) fraudulently gives false or fictitious information in any application for a special license plate, as authorized in this article, (b) conceals a material fact in any such application, or (c) otherwise commits a fraud in any such application or in the use of any special license plate issued pursuant to this article is guilty of a misdemeanor and, upon conviction, must be punished by a fine of not more than one hundred dollars or thirty days' imprisonment, or both.

Legislative History
HISTORY: 1984 Act No. 512, Part II, SECTION 67. ARTICLE 32 Temporary License Plates and Registration Cards For Trailers and Semi-Trailers
